Steventon Pre-school is a friendly, fun and safe educational setting for children aged two years nine months until they start primary school. Our aim is to enhance the development and education of children under statutory school age in a parent-involving, community based group.
Our sessions are for up to 22 children per morning session and 12 per lunch club and afternoon session. We are open for 38 weeks of the year, mostly coinciding with school term dates.
Our session times are currently 8.45 – 11.45 and 12.00 to 3.00, Monday to Thursday and 8.45 to 11.45 on Friday. Children wishing to stay all day can bring a packed lunch for a nominal charge. We hope to be able to offer more flexible hours shortly.
After registration, children play freely with the toys, games and table activities (these are changed daily). This is followed by time for a drink, snack and fruit with group discussion. We then play outside, weather permitting. All the children then come back indoors for singing, music and story time before being collected by their parent or carer.
